Billet prices tumble in China, ASEAN

Billet prices have ticked lower during the week in China and ASEAN, Kallanish notes.

A recent deal for Chinese 5sp 150mm billet is heard to have closed at $457-458/tonne cfr Manila during the week through 22 August, market sources say. A previous order concluded a week earlier closed at $465/t cfr.

Offers are now prevailing at $455/t cfr Manila. Buyers are cautious amid the softening in the market. “We will probably have a better feel by next week. For this week, customers aren’t exactly jumping up and down from excitement because of the price drops,” a Manila trader said last Friday.

In Indonesia, rerollers are receiving Chinese 3sp 150mm billet offers at $455/t cfr Jakarta. For 5sp, the offers would be around $460/t cfr. Offers for 5sp billet were $468/t cfr around 15 August.

Indonesia’s Dexin Steel is offering 3sp 150mm base billet at $450/t fob, down $5/t since 14 August.

Kallanish assessed 5sp/ps or Q275 120/125/130mm square billet last Friday at $460/t cfr Manila, down $7.5/t on-week.

In China, 3sp 150mm billet dropped by around $9/t week-on-week to $440/t last Friday while the most traded October 2025 rebar contract on Shanghai Futures Exchange fell by CNY 69/t ($9.6/t).

Trading sources in China said they were seeing improved export sales during the week through 22 August. "Export transactions at this price are good," a trader says. The price of 5sp billet prices was $5/t higher than that of 3sp.
